cat 2024 slot 1 analysis download pdf

Rajeswari Dey 16th Jun, 2025

Hi aspirant,

CAT 2024 Slot 1 , held on November 24 , 2024 , was widely regarded as being of easy to moderate difficulty , and significantly easier than CAT 2023 .

  1. The total number of questions increased from 66 to 68, mostly due to two new questions in the DILR section, and there were no para jumbles in VARC.
  2. VARC was rated as intermediate , with an emphasis on reading comprehension.
  3. DILR , despite the increased number of questions , was generally seen as simpler than the previous year , with a combination of 4- and 5-question sets.
  4. Quantitative Aptitude was likewise evaluated as easier than CAT 2023, with a heavy emphasis on Arithmetic and Algebra .
